Initially at first as a group we had decided that there would be a group of three young teenagers from 14-
17/18 that get together and possibly discover and explore the story behind a 19th Century alleged witch
that was hung for being so, but somehow after a night of being hung she hung on for dear life and was
eventually cut down. The mistake of others not knowing her survival, she goes on to live another 14 years
but in deep madness. In this unfortunate insanity she walked around mumbling and talking to herself,
eating wrong things such as faeces and insects and basically trapped in a life episode of sheer unique
madness for the wrong blaming of witch craft. But the uncertainty of her actually being a witch is
unknown. These teens, as group, go onto investigate this woman as a spirit now and want to unveil her
true story from a small myth they have heard. But trouble lies in their way from possible possession,
obsession and spirit stalking.
We thought of three casual teen charactersgoing into this project together, one female and two males.
Stereotypically making the girl a vulnerable more isolated gender already (this being a noticed facet of a
horror movie). There would also be two males, obviously, one nerdy and one more ‘jock’ like with a
careless attitude. There would also be other non-protagonists such as teachers and class extras. But the
big star would be the spirit of the witch ‘Half-HangedMary’ (which is based on a true story).
However from this idea, our mind-mapping and brainstorming lead to a development in our narration of
the film. Three main teenagersturned to one vulnerable girl, to add more tense isolation to the story.
Alongside this we inputted a twist to the story. Where ‘Half-Hanged Mary’, in past, possessed and initially
tortured the lives of three other characters. Two possibly un-survived or strangely disappeared and one
possible elderly survivor of such a story that helps the girl come to the realism of the alleged witch. This is
a story of true mystery but horror and unveiling the truth, and tearing it from its myth status. But so far
we leave questions as to whether the girl survives this project or whether the ending is leaving us untold
as to whether she is successful or disappears.
We think this was a more gripping and intriguing story for an audience as the girl alone would be more
innocent and helpless, the survivor would help give the viewer the needed information on the witch and
the central witch being different from demons, she is simply a psychotic spirit seeking her unfinished
business on revenge of those who are no longer there. It, simultaneously, follows the aspects of horror
but also contrasts it with its realism and untold story.
